How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 35215?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
35215 Studio Apartments | $690 | $690 | $690 |
35215 1 Bedroom Apartments | $886 | $620 | $2,208 |
35215 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,014 | $660 | $2,143 |
35215 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,202 | $755 | $3,178 |
35215 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,575 | $1,575 | $1,575 |
